Output 20d1c69adcdb026cbc93a3ad351611093da0ad750c604649ca5438e3fcbceac6:121

value
6384549
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88b0d21b456624be571fa9543d0ca2e000cabafe OP_EQUALVERIFY OP_CHECKSIG
address
1DTkiotwq6RMTPpDWZv3cq8HMpxtcSYZ1X
transaction
20d1c69adcdb026cbc93a3ad351611093da0ad750c604649ca5438e3fcbceac6
confirmations
574103
spent
true